(Untended Grass And Weeds) The Code Enforcement Board of the City of Winter Springs, Florida, sat in Hearing on March 16, 2004 in the matter of Rebecca C. Patrick to determine whether she is in Violation of Section 13-2. (Untended Grass and Weeds) of the Code of the City of Winter Springs, Florida. Upon hearing all evidence on the matter, the Board arrived at the following: FINDING OF FACT: "In the case of [City] Winter Springs versus Rebecca C. Patrick, Code Enforcement Board [CASE] Number 03-0004405, the Code Enforcement Board has read the complaint filed and written information prepared by the Code Inspector and heard at this Hearing the sworn testimony of the Code Inspector. Based upon the evidence and testimony presented at this Hearing, I Move that the Code Enforcement Board find that the Violator, Rebecca C. Patrick was provided notice in accordance with Section 2-59. of the City Code that a Violation of Section 13-2., tlnattended Grass and Weeds, of the City Code existed. (1) That the Violator was provided a reasonable time to correct said Violations. (2) That the Violator failed or refused to correct such Violation within the time provided. (3) That the Violator was provided notice in accordance with Section 2-59. of the City Code of the Hearing before the Code Enforcement Board and that the Violator was not present at this Hearing. (4) That said Violations exist upon the Violator's property. CITY OF WINTER SPRINGS CODE ENFORCEMENT BOARD CASE NUMBER #03-0004405 MARCH 16, 2004 PAGE 2 OF 2 I further Move that an appropriate Relief Order be issued immediately by the Code Enforcement Board." RELIEF ORDER: "In the case of the City of Winter Springs versus Rebecca C. Patrick, Code Enforcement Board [CASE) Number 03-[000]4405, the Violator Rebecca C. Patrick has been found in -Violation of Section 13-2. of the City Code. Therefore, I move the Violator be given three (3) days after notification to correct this Violation of the City Code. If the Violation is not corrected within the time provided, a fine of One Hundred Dollars ($100.00) a day shall be imposed per Violation until Compliance is achieved as verified by the Code Enforcement Inspector of the City of Winter Springs. I further move that the violator be notified by this Board that any future Violations of this Section of the City Code [ 13-2.] shall be considered a `Reoccurrence' or `Repeat Violation' requiring further proceedings before this Board without the necessity of giving the Violator -reasonable time to correct said future Violations. Additionally, if such a `Repeat Violation' is found to have existed, a fine shall be imposed in the amount of Five Hundred Dollars ($500) per day.
